What Is a Predictive CRM Solution?

A predictive CRM solution is a customer relationship management platform enhanced with artificial intelligence and predictive analytics.

Instead of simply storing customer data, predictive CRM systems analyze historical activity, behavioral patterns, engagement trends, and sales performance to forecast future outcomes.

These platforms can help businesses answer questions such as:

  • Which leads are most likely to convert?

  • Which deals are at risk of stalling?

  • Which customers may churn soon?

  • What revenue is likely to close this quarter?

How Predictive CRM Differs From Traditional CRM

Traditional CRM systems mainly function as databases for storing customer information, notes, and sales activity.

Predictive CRM platforms go much further by turning that information into actionable insights. AI models continuously analyze customer behavior and pipeline activity to help teams make smarter decisions in real time.

This shift changes CRM from a passive record-keeping system into an active sales intelligence tool.

Why Traditional CRM Systems Fall Short

Many older CRM systems create visibility into customer data but still leave sales teams relying heavily on manual interpretation and guesswork.

Reactive Instead of Proactive

Traditional CRM systems are often reactive.

They store information after activities happen but do little to help sales teams anticipate future outcomes. Reps may see pipeline updates, but they still need to determine which opportunities deserve immediate attention.

Predictive CRM systems help surface those insights automatically.

Manual Forecasting Errors

Forecasting has traditionally depended on spreadsheets, subjective judgment, and inconsistent reporting.

Different sales reps may estimate deals differently, which can create unreliable revenue projections. Predictive analytics helps reduce this uncertainty by using historical data patterns instead of assumptions alone.

Missed Revenue Opportunities

Sales teams can easily overlook high-intent prospects when too much data exists without prioritization.

Without predictive insights, valuable leads may receive the same attention as low-probability opportunities, slowing overall sales performance.

Limited Prioritization

Sales reps only have so much time each day.

When CRM systems fail to rank opportunities intelligently, teams may spend too much effort chasing low-value deals instead of focusing on prospects most likely to close.

Core Benefits of a Predictive CRM Solution

Predictive CRM platforms help sales organizations operate more efficiently while improving forecasting and decision-making.

Better Lead Scoring

AI-driven lead scoring helps sales teams prioritize prospects more accurately.

The system analyzes behavior patterns, engagement activity, demographics, and previous conversions to rank leads based on likelihood to convert.

This allows sales reps to focus their attention where it is most likely to produce results.

More Accurate Revenue Forecasting

Forecasting becomes more reliable when it is supported by real-time analytics and historical performance data.

Predictive CRM systems can identify patterns within the pipeline that may not be obvious manually. This helps leadership teams make better operational and financial decisions.

Improved Sales Productivity

Sales productivity improves when teams spend less time sorting through data manually.

Predictive insights help representatives prioritize high-value opportunities, automate routine tasks, and reduce administrative work that slows the sales process.

Stronger Customer Retention

Predictive CRM platforms are not limited to new sales opportunities.

Many systems can identify churn risks, declining engagement patterns, or upcoming renewal opportunities before customers are lost. This allows teams to take proactive steps to improve retention.

Key Features to Look For

Not every CRM platform offers the same level of predictive intelligence.

Businesses evaluating solutions should look for features that support both automation and actionable forecasting.

AI-Driven Lead Scoring

Lead scoring should automatically rank opportunities based on conversion probability.

This helps teams prioritize outreach more strategically instead of relying entirely on intuition.

Opportunity Win Probability Insights

Predictive CRM systems should provide visibility into which deals are most likely to close successfully.

These insights help managers allocate resources more effectively across the pipeline.

Automated Follow-Up Recommendations

AI-driven recommendations can help sales reps maintain momentum with prospects.

Some systems suggest follow-up timing, outreach priorities, or engagement strategies based on customer behavior patterns.

Forecast Dashboards and Analytics

Strong reporting and visualization tools are essential.

Forecast dashboards should provide clear insights into pipeline health, expected revenue, deal stages, and performance trends.

Integrations With Marketing and Sales Tools

CRM intelligence becomes more valuable when systems work together.

Integrations with email platforms, marketing automation tools, communication systems, and analytics platforms help create a more complete view of customer behavior.

Best Practices for Successful Implementation

Technology alone does not guarantee better results.

Businesses often see the strongest outcomes when predictive CRM systems are supported by strong processes and consistent adoption.

Maintain Clean and Centralized Data

Predictive analytics relies heavily on accurate information.

Incomplete or outdated customer data can reduce forecasting quality and lead-scoring accuracy.

Train Teams on Workflows and Adoption

Even advanced systems require proper onboarding.

Sales and marketing teams should understand how predictive insights work and how to incorporate them into daily workflows.

Review Model Performance Regularly

AI models improve over time, but they still require monitoring.

Regular reviews help ensure predictions remain accurate as customer behavior and market conditions evolve.

Combine Human Judgment With AI Insights

Predictive analytics works best when combined with human experience.

AI can identify patterns and probabilities, but sales professionals still provide context, relationship management, and strategic decision-making.
